-
在加密货币挖矿的浪潮中,以太坊(ETH)曾以其独特的经济模型和技术特性,成为无数矿工追逐的目标,而在构建高效、稳定且成本可控的挖矿农场时,Linux操作系统与GPU(图形处理器)的组合,无疑是一套备受推崇的“黄金搭档”,这套组合凭借其强大的算力潜力、灵活的定制能力和相对较低的系统资源开销,在以太坊挖矿乃至其他依赖GPU计算的加密货币挖矿领域,占据了举足轻重的地位。

为何选择Linux进行GPU挖矿?
相较于Windows操作系统,Linux在挖矿场景下展现出诸多优势:
- 资源占用低:Linux内核精简,系统服务较少,在运行挖矿软件时,能将更多的CPU资源留给GPU挖矿程序进行辅助计算,减少不必要的系统开销,从而可能带来轻微的算力提升和更低的功耗。
- 稳定性高:Linux系统以其出色的稳定性和可靠性著称,能够长时间不间断运行,对于需要7x24小时连续工作的挖矿设备而言,系统的稳定性至关重要,可以有效减少因系统崩溃或蓝屏导致的停机时间和收益损失。
- 命令行操作高效:Linux强大的命令行界面(CLI)让矿工能够更精细、更高效地管理挖矿进程、监控设备状态、调整参数,通过编写脚本,还可以实现自动化管理,如定时重启、远程监控报警等,大大提升了运维效率。
- 免费与开源:绝大多数Linux发行版都是免费且开源的,这显著了降低了挖矿初期的软件成本,开源的特性也意味着社区活跃,遇到问题更容易找到解决方案和获取技术支持。
- 安全性高:Linux系统相对Windows而言,病毒和恶意软件的威胁更小,这对于保障挖矿资产和系统安全具有重要意义。
GPU:以太坊挖矿的核心引擎

在以太坊挖矿(PoW共识机制下)中,GPU之所以成为绝对的主力,主要得益于其:
- 并行计算能力:GPU拥有数千个小型计算核心,擅长处理大规模并行计算任务,而以太坊的挖矿算法(Ethash)正是一种需要大量哈希运算的并行计算任务,GPU能够同时执行大量计算单元,从而远超CPU的挖矿效率。
- 高性价比算力:相较于专门为挖矿设计的ASIC(专用集成电路)芯片,GPU具有更高的通用性,除了挖矿,GPU还可用于游戏、图形设计、视频编辑、科学计算等,当加密货币市场低迷时,矿工可以转售或转用GPU,降低投资风险,在以太坊挖矿时代,中高端GPU如NVIDIA的GeRTX系列(如1080 Ti、30系)和AMD的RX系列(如Vega、5700/6000系)因其出色的能效比和算力,成为矿工们的首选。
- 灵活性与可升级性:矿工可以根据自己的预算和需求,灵活选择不同型号和数量的GPU组建挖矿机,GPU驱动程序和挖矿软件的更新也相对频繁,能够不断优化挖矿性能。
Linux下GPU挖矿的关键环节
在Linux系统上进行GPU挖矿,通常涉及以下几个关键步骤:

- 硬件选择与准备:选择合适的GPU型号,确保数量充足且兼容,准备好稳定的电源、散热良好的机箱以及足够的内存(通常建议8GB以上,以避免GPU显存不足)。
- Linux发行版选择:对于新手,Ubuntu LTS(长期支持版)因其庞大的用户社区和丰富的教程资源,是较为友好的选择,对于追求极致性能和定制的老手,可能会选择轻量级的发行版如Linux Mint、Xubuntu或专门的挖矿优化版Linux。
- 驱动安装:安装对应GPU厂商(NVIDIA或AMD)的官方Linux驱动,这是确保GPU能够被系统正确识别和发挥性能的基础,NVIDIA驱动通常通过.run文件或官方仓库安装,AMD驱动则可通过amdgpu-pro或开源驱动。
- 挖矿软件安装与配置:
- NVIDIA GPU:常用挖矿软件如NBMiner、T-Rex、Gminer等,这些软件通常针对NVIDIA GPU进行了优化,支持多种算法。
- AMD GPU:常用挖矿软件如TeamRedMiner、lolMiner、PhoenixMiner等。
- 这些软件通常提供预编译的二进制文件,下载解压后通过命令行运行即可,配置文件(如.bat或.sh文件)中需要指定矿池地址、钱包地址、挖矿软件名称及参数等。
- 矿池选择:加入矿池是提高收益稳定性的常见方式,矿池将多个矿工的算力集中起来共同挖矿,根据贡献分配奖励,选择一个稳定、手续费合理、支付及时的矿池至关重要。
- 监控与维护:利用Linux的命令行工具(如
top, htop, nvidia-smi, rocm-smi)或第三方监控软件(如Gminer的web界面)实时监控GPU温度、功耗、算力、风扇转速等参数,确保设备在最佳状态下运行,并及时处理可能出现的故障。
时代的落幕与遗产
随着以太坊从PoW向PoS(权益证明)的转变,GPU挖矿在以太坊网络中已成为历史,这场变革使得大量依赖以太坊挖矿的GPU矿工不得不转向其他PoW算法的加密货币,或者将GPU转用于其他计算任务。
Linux GPU在挖矿领域所积累的经验和技术,并未随之消逝,它证明了开源系统与通用硬件在特定计算场景下的强大潜力,这套组合所体现的高效、稳定、可定制的理念,依然在其他依赖GPU计算的加密货币挖矿(如一些小币种)、AI训练、科学计算等领域发挥着重要作用,对于许多技术爱好者而言,在Linux环境下配置GPU挖矿,也曾经是一段探索硬件极限、深入理解系统运作的宝贵经历。
-